How are crowds on rides during MNSSHP?

I've been to a few September parties (my favorite time to go to MNSSHP, by the way). Most rides are going to be walk-on or very short lines, like 5-10 mins. Popular rides like 7DMT will always tend to have some level of line, like 15-30 minutes. Slower loading rides like PP or the speedway may be like 10-20.

You may see a rush on rides after things like the parade and fireworks, but that moves through pretty quickly.

Party crowds can feel very "lumpy" at times. You'll be in the hub and it'll be a zoo, but you can go ride Barnstormer three times in a row with no one else around. It's an odd feeling.

Trying to determine if rides are walk on during a MNSSHP, specifically in mid-September. TIA

Our experience has been that ride lines tend to be short or walk on, and that is even more true later in the night and during the parade and fireworks. Earlier in the night, lines might not be as short. Most people at the party tend to gravitate toward the dance parties, character meet and greets, show, parade and fireworks with rides being the lowest priority.

BTW, one other thing I'll point out. With no FP's, you'll be amazed how fast a normal standby line can move. Things like 7DMT will move MUCH MUCH quicker than the normal standby line since you're not sharing capacity with the FP folks. So even if a line "looks" long, it's going to move a bit quicker than you think.
